A simple thermodynamic model, based on an extension of Flory-Huggins theory, is applied to temperature rising elution fractionation (TREF). Dependence of the fractionation process on melting temperature, melting enthalpy, average crystallinity, average crystallizable sequence length, and polymer-solvent interaction parameter is predicted. Results from the model fit experimental TREF data, and correctly predict number-average branch points for TREF fractions. © 1995 John Wiley & Sons, Inc.  相似文献

Single crystal X-ray diffraction and IR spectroscopy have been used to study the conformation of 2-hydroxyphenyl 2-hydroxy-2-(-naphthyl)vinyl ketone in solid state. It was found that one of the two possible enol tautomeric forms is stabilized in the crystal. The 1-hydroxy-3-oxo-1,3-propenylene moiety, O=C—CH=C—OH, shows a strong intramolecular H bond with a definite character of reasonance-assisted hydrogen bond in spite of being in competition with ring intermolecular hydrogen bonds. The comparison of the present results with solution NMR data indicates that the molecular geometry in solid state and in solution are similar.  相似文献

Internal pressures and cohesive energy densities of binary liquid mixtures of n-pentane+dichloromethane, n-pentane+methylacetate, 2-propanol+methylacetate and n-bytylamine+1,4-dioxane at 25°C have been evaluated from molar volumes surface tensions and enthalpies. The data obtained provide information about interactions in the binary liquid mixtures which can be correlated with results from other thermodynamic properties.Presented at the VI Congreso Argentino de Fisicoquímica, Santiago del Estero, Argentina, 1989.  相似文献

The synthesis of twelve tetrahydro‐β‐carboline derivatives 3a , 3b , 3c , 3d , 3e , 3f , 3g , 3h , 3i , 3j , 3k , 3l prepared via the Pictet–Spengler reaction is described. The reaction of tryptamine and a variety of arylaldehydes were carried out under ultrasonic irradiation and trifluoracetic acid catalysis at room temperature. These tetrahydro‐β‐carbolines have been synthesized in higher yields and shorter reaction times compared to the conventional method. Moreover, the reaction proceeded successfully even employing arylaldehydes with electron‐donating or electron‐attracting substituents which did not react under conventional method.  相似文献

The crystal structure of the title compound, C30H48O3, a triterpene extracted from the resin of Protium crenatum Sandwith, is reported. The aliphatic acidic side chain is attached to the tirucallene four‐ring system on its α‐face and is extended by 7.248 (5) Å in the `left‐hand' orientation.  相似文献

This paper presents investigations of free vibration of anisotropic plates of different geometrical shapes and generally restrained boundaries. The existence and uniqueness of weak solutions of boundary value problems and eigenvalue problems which correspond to the statical and dynamical behaviour of the mentioned plates is demonstrated. It is determined that when the plates have corner points formed by the intersection of edges free or elastically restrained against translation, the corresponding bilinear forms maintain the V – ellipticity property.  相似文献

In this article, two second-order constraint qualifications for the vector optimization problem are introduced, that come from first-order constraint qualifications, originally devised for the scalar case. The first is based on the classical feasible arc constraint qualification, proposed by Kuhn and Tucker (Proceedings of the Second Berkeley Symposium on Mathematical Statistics and Probability, vol. 1, pp. 481–492, University of California Press, California, 1951) together with a slight modification of McCormick’s second-order constraint qualification. The second—the constant rank constraint qualification—was introduced by Janin (Math. Program. Stud. 21:110–126, 1984). They are used to establish two second-order necessary conditions for the vector optimization problem, with general nonlinear constraints, without any convexity assumption.  相似文献

Nanoscale characterization of zein self-assembly   总被引:1,自引:0,他引:1  
Zein, a major protein of corn, is rich in α-helical structure. It has an amphiphilic character and is capable of self-assembly. Zein can self-assemble into various mesostructures that may find applications in food, agricultural, and biomedical engineering. Understanding the mechanism of zein self-assembly at the nanoscale is important for further development of zein structures. In this work, high-resolution transmission electron microscopy (TEM) images revealed nanosize zein stripes, rings, and discs containing a 0.35 nm periodicity, which is characteristic of β-sheet. TEM images were interpreted in terms of the transformation of original α-helices into β-sheet conformation after evaporation-induced self-assembly (EISA). The presence of β-sheet was also detected by circular dichroism (CD) spectroscopy. Zein β-sheets self-assembled into stripes, which curled into rings. Rings formed discs and eventually spheres. The formation of zein nanostructures was believed to be the result of β-sheet orientation, alignment, and packing.  相似文献
